Polymeric materials with engineered refractive indices for applications in the THz regime can be fabricated and processed by conventional melt‐processing of inorganic nanomaterials and conventional host polymers. The approach opens up new opportunities for the creation of optical elements to manipulate the technologically relevant THz radiation, for example photonic crystals.
